Well done Team FORCE at the Great West Run

Congratulations to every member of Team FORCE who took to the streets of Exeter for the 2025 Great West Run.

You did yourselves proud and you did FORCE proud too so thank you all.

There were nearly 700 of you making every step count in supporting local people dealing with cancer.

You have raised a staggering £188,000 so far and we know there’s more to come.

We’re having to pinch ourselves at the size of that number. It will make a significant difference in our support for thousands of people in our community whose lives have been turned upside down by a cancer diagnosis.

£200,000 would fund FORCE’s Oncology Support Specialist Service for eight months, ensuring cancer patients and their families receive expert counselling, compassionate care and emotional support at a time when it matters most.

“It was an amazing day with so many incredible and inspiring stories from our runners and the people supporting them. We laughed, we cried, we cheered and we were left in awe of the commitment shown by so many people,” said Chloe Richardson from the FORCE fundraising team.
